Which attribute is NOT emphasized during demonstration-quality skills?

  1. Speed of execution

  2. Slow pacing

  3. Sequence emphasized

  4. Critical attributes emphasized

The correct answer is: Speed of execution

In the context of demonstration-quality skills, the focus is on clarity and effectiveness rather than speed. When teaching or demonstrating skills, the goal is to ensure that students can clearly see and understand each aspect of the skill being performed. Therefore, slow pacing is encouraged, as it allows for better observation and comprehension. The sequence of actions is also crucial, as it helps to reinforce learning and ensure that students can replicate the skills in the correct order. Finally, critical attributes are emphasized; these are the key points that need to be highlighted to ensure that skills are performed safely and effectively. In this context, speed of execution is not emphasized because rushing through a skill can lead to misunderstandings or mistakes, diminishing the quality of the demonstration. Ensuring that students have a proper grasp of the skill is paramount, and this is best achieved through measured and deliberate practice.
